**Q: How do I unlock the staging config for PanCalc, our recipe-scaling calculator?**

Good question — everyone hits this in week one. PanCalc's scaling engine reads its conversion tables from a sealed config bundle, and staging resets it every Sunday. You'll need to re-open it before testing batch multipliers, otherwise every recipe scales to zero (fun bug, not really). Ask your buddy on the Breadline team if you get stuck. The passphrase to reseal the bundle is below.

unlock words, fahop-yageg: ralwyn-kelath

Handover note — Crumbwheel order cutoffs.

Welcome aboard. The bakery cutoff rule in Crumbwheel closes same-day orders at 14:00 local to each storefront, not UTC — this has bitten us twice. Holiday overrides live in the calendar service and take precedence silently, so always check there first when a cutoff looks wrong. To unlock the calendar service's admin console after a restart, enter the recovery passphrase below.

vault phrase of bagap-bahaf = silion-pelox-sorox-casdor-quenwyn-fraax-eliox-praael-kelion-quenvan-kasox-rusael-norius-belvan

**Q: What if the Brightlea Clinic reminder job fails overnight?**

A: The ReminderRunner task at Brightlea Clinic sends appointment texts at 06:00. If it fails, restart it from the Opsboard console. Restarting requires unlocking the scheduler vault, which a contractor can do with the on-call recovery passphrase. The current passphrase is listed below.

recovery phrase for fawif-tajeg: norael-aldmir-casir-brivan-ulaion